    As a Californian resident, one has access to a wealth of state services designed to aid individuals. From academic opportunities to monetary assistance programs, California's government is dedicated to providing essential resources for all. Utilizing these services can be enhanced by understanding how they work.

    • Begin your journey by visiting the official California State website, a extensive resource for details on available services.
    • Contact your local representative for personalized guidance on relevant programs and support.
    • Stay informed by subscribing to state newsletters and updates for timely information about changes or current initiatives.

    Remember that each service may have specific eligibility requirements and application processes. It's always best to verify the details before applying for any program.
